Abstract: 

This product uses standardized patients in dramatizations that focus on teaching as well as clinical care. There are two takes to the dramatizations. The second take incorporates comments that learners who have viewed the dramatizations suggest as well as pre planned alterations for take two. The user will view the actual dramatizatizations on CD ROM and the scripts used to create them. To obtain a copy of the CD ROM, please contact the author.

Educational objectives: 

This module is designed to: -Enhance audience participation -Reinforce geriatrics teaching points -Present geriatrics clinical application of Relationship-Centered Care -Present clinical application of teaching geriatrics The learner will be able to: 1) Teach geriatrics content 2) Apply the Four Habits Model of Relationship-Centered Care 3) Understand the clinical application of geriatric syndromes (dementia, depression, falls and urinary incontinence)

Additional information/Special implementation requirements or guidelines: 

The CD ROM may be used to train standardized patients to become "GENI Players" or for the audience demonstration. Praciticing physicians and residents have used this product.
